Adaptation and Optimization of J1939 Cable in Electric Heavy duty Vehicles
With the acceleration of the electrification transformation of heavy vehicles, J1939 cables are facing new adaptation needs, no longer limited to the communication scenarios of traditional fuel equipment, but specially optimized for core requirements such as high-voltage environment, battery management, and motor control of electric heavy vehicles, becoming the core supporting component of the electric control system of electric heavy vehicles. Compared with the J1939 cable used in traditional fuel vehicles, electric vehicle specific cables need to balance signal transmission and high-voltage protection, achieving a dual improvement in communication stability and safety.

In electric heavy-duty vehicles, J1939 cables are mainly used for communication between battery management systems (BMS), motor controllers, and vehicle controllers (VCU), transmitting key data such as battery SOC, motor speed, and high-voltage circuit status, which directly affects the vehicle's range, power output, and safety performance. To adapt to high-voltage environments, cables need to use high-voltage resistant insulation materials, optimize shielding structures, prevent high-voltage electromagnetic interference signal transmission, and have flame retardant and anti leakage characteristics to avoid safety hazards in high-voltage scenarios.
At present, J1939 cables suitable for electric heavy-duty vehicles have achieved technological upgrades. With the increasing penetration rate of electric heavy-duty vehicles, the high-voltage adaptation technology of J1939 cables will become a key focus of industry research and development.
